Freedom Without Security Portends Chaos, Perpetual Anxiety And Fear. Security Without Freedom Means Slavery. So, Each On Its Own Is Awful; Only Together They Make For A Good Life. But, A Big "but": Being Both Necessary, Complementing Each Other, They Are Nevertheless Virtually Incompatible.
-Zygmunt Bauman
